In today's rapidly evolving digital landscape, businesses must adapt to stay competitive. One critical aspect of this adaptation is application modernization. This process involves updating legacy software systems to align with current business needs and technological advancements. By embracing application modernization, companies can enhance efficiency, reduce costs, and deliver superior customer experiences.

1. Enhanced Business Agility

Modernized applications enable businesses to respond swiftly to market changes and customer demands. By adopting flexible architectures like microservices and leveraging cloud technologies, organizations can deploy new features faster and scale operations seamlessly. This agility is crucial for maintaining a competitive edge in dynamic markets.

2. Improved User Experience

User expectations have evolved, and outdated applications often fail to meet these standards. Modern applications offer intuitive interfaces, faster load times, and seamless navigation, leading to increased user satisfaction and loyalty. Enhancing the user experience can significantly impact customer retention and brand reputation.

3. Increased Operational Efficiency

Legacy systems often require manual interventions and are prone to errors, leading to inefficiencies. Modernizing applications automates processes, reduces redundancies, and streamlines workflows. This transformation boosts employee productivity and allows teams to focus on strategic initiatives rather than routine maintenance.

4. Cost Reduction

Maintaining outdated systems can be expensive due to high maintenance costs and resource requirements. Application modernization reduces these expenses by migrating to cost-effective platforms, optimizing resource utilization, and minimizing downtime. Over time, this leads to significant savings and better allocation of IT budgets.

5. Enhanced Security and Compliance

Security threats are continually evolving, and legacy applications often lack the necessary defenses. Modern applications incorporate advanced security protocols, regular updates, and compliance measures to protect sensitive data. This proactive approach minimizes risks and ensures adherence to industry regulations.

6. Better Integration Capabilities

Modern applications are designed to integrate seamlessly with other systems, tools, and platforms. This interoperability facilitates data sharing, improves collaboration across departments, and enables the adoption of emerging technologies like AI and IoT. Enhanced integration capabilities support a more cohesive and efficient IT ecosystem.

7. Future-Proofing Your Business

Technology is advancing at an unprecedented pace, and businesses must stay ahead to remain relevant. Application modernization ensures that your systems are adaptable to future technological trends and market demands. By building scalable and flexible applications, organizations can quickly pivot and innovate as needed.

8. Improved Data Insights

Modern applications often come equipped with advanced analytics and reporting tools. These features provide real-time insights into business operations, customer behaviors, and market trends. Leveraging this data enables informed decision-making, strategic planning, and the identification of new growth opportunities.
